A powerful tool for modifying WIC (OpenEmbedded Image Creator) images used in embedded Linux development. Originally designed for NXP i.MX8MM EVK boards using Yocto Project builds, but compatible with any WIC-based embedded Linux system.
About WIC Images: The name "WIC" is derived from OpenEmbedded Image Creator (oeic). WIC is a standalone utility that provides flexible partitioning functionality for OpenEmbedded build artifacts, based on Redhat kickstart syntax. It's loosely based on the Meego Image Creator (mic) framework but heavily modified to work directly with OpenEmbedded artifacts.
🚀 Features
- Advanced Partition Detection: Multiple methods to identify and select target partitions
- Intelligent File Conflict Handling: Interactive resolution with diff capabilities
- File Deletion Support: Remove unwanted files before adding new ones
- Flexible Input/Output: Handles both compressed (.wic.gz) and uncompressed (.wic) images
- Interactive and Automated Modes: Perfect for both development and CI/CD workflows
- Comprehensive Partition Analysis: Detailed information about all partitions in WIC images
- Safe Operation: Uses loop devices with proper cleanup and error handling
- UUU Integration: Optimized for NXP Universal Update Utility workflows
